USA in a Glass: A Deep Dive into the Grape Varieties That Dominate American Winemaking

Uncover the fascinating world of American wines, a winemaking giant that defies tradition and forges its own identity of excellence and innovation.

Far from being merely a reflection of European styles, American wine is a breathtaking geoclimatic mosaic, with wines of exceptional quality springing from all 50 states.

In this in-depth and engaging compendium, you will be guided by the insightful lens of a sommelier on a journey through the most emblematic grapes and regions of the USA:

Iconic Reds: Dive into the realms of Cabernet Sauvignon (from the power of Napa Valley to the structured elegance of Washington State), discover the velvety versatility of Merlot, the delicate allure of Oregon Pinot Noir, and the powerful, fruity character of Californian Zinfandel.

Outstanding Whites: Understand the dominance of Chardonnay, from light and mineral styles to the rich and buttery Californian wines, the aromatic freshness of Sauvignon Blanc, and the potential of Riesling in cooler climates.
